摘要: Eating Plan 2019南昌G 模数为合数,所以只有约3000个数字不为0 记录一下不为0的数字位置 H[x]代表距离为x的连续段的数字和的最大值 处理出H[x] 再H[x] = max(H[x],H[x-1])记录下前缀最大, 对每个询问二分答案 #include<bits/stdc++. 阅读全文
posted @ 2019-12-10 10:30 liulex 阅读(350) 评论(0) 推荐(0) 编辑
摘要: https://vjudge.net/problem/HRBUST-2455 有两种优惠方式,一是满400减100,另外一种是商品自带折扣,二者不可叠加 dp[i][j]表示前i种商品,(参与满400减100活动的商品价格之和)%400 == j 的最少总花费,这里默认后面的商品都使用自身折扣, 为 阅读全文
posted @ 2019-12-10 09:00 liulex 阅读(189) 评论(0) 推荐(0) 编辑